I'm searching the active Worksheet for a value and when found I want to
scroll to the row the value was found on as the ActiveWindow.ScrollRow. Assuming the value was found in Range("A" & j + 5) how would I scroll to it? This did not work... ActiveWindow.ScrollRow = ActiveWindow.Range("A" & j + 5).Row |
